GlobalFlyer Repaired, May Move To KSC On Thursday
The Virgin Atlantic GlobalFlyer will move from Salina, Kan., to NASA's Kennedy Space Center tomorrow after the aircraft's wing was damaged last week. The planned attempt at the world's longest flight did not slip as late as some had worried, but it may not launch until the end of February. "The...
